关注Cell处理器的朋友一定会很熟悉Mercury Computer Systems。正是这家与IBM有着密切合作的公司,在2006年相继推出了第一台双路Cell刀片服务器和Cell加速扩展板,大大拓展了这颗处理器的应用领域。现在,该公司又发布了一个新的开发包(SDK),可以让PS3游戏机摇身变成一个高性能超级计算平台。
Mercury今天发布的是一套“PS3多核心增强开发包-基础版”,本月6日还会在计算机图形学年会Siggraph 2007上推出“PS3多核心增强开发包-科学运算库扩展增强版”,可以让不同层次的专业开发人员全面挖掘PS3 Cell处理器的潜力。
基础版开发包的售价为399美元。Mercury称,它会在“可以接受”的价位上提供诸多工具,全面释放Cell处理器的能力,并简化多核心编程的难度,比如其中的轨迹追踪工具,可以监控动态多处理器和多核心交互,自动检测性能瓶颈,并形象化地指出问题所在。
增强版开发包地价格没有披露,但Mercury保证说,其中含有“600多种用于计算优化应用的功能”,还有“100多个专为Cell架构优化的图像和信号处理功能”。
Mercury的开发包支持YellowDog Linux系统,不过其中一些应用需要一台x86 PC做主机才能实现。
自发布PS3以来,索尼就一直强调它不仅仅是一台游戏机,也是未来的多媒体家庭娱乐中心,而且由于Cell处理器计算能力强大,PS3也因此成了诸多第三方应用的宠爱,尤其是3月份发起的Folding@Home PS3项目,更是得到了索尼官方的支持,成为目前最流行的第三方科学计算应用。
“它不是一台游戏机!”